Government College Women University Faisalabad organized a prestigious ceremony to celebrate the 75th anniversary of Pakistan-China friendship. Chief Guest Farooq Yousaf Sheikh, President FCCI, along with Patron-in-Chief Prof. Dr. Kanwal Ameen, Vice Chancellor GC Women University Faisalabad, inaugurated a poster exhibition on the diplomatic relations between Pakistan and China. The event started with the national anthems of both countries. Faculty coordinators, members, students, and a special delegation from the Confucius Center at UAF attended the cultural performances and cake-cutting ceremony at Jinnah Auditorium.ÚÚAddressing the gathering, Farooq Yousaf Sheikh described Pakistan-China friendship as a timeless symbol of trust, sacrifice, and shared progress. He said CPEC has strengthened economic cooperation, termed Faisalabad the backbone of Pakistan’s economy, and urged youth to adopt innovative thinking for national progress and economic stability. Vice Chancellor GCWUF Prof. Dr. Kanwal Ameen stated that over the past 75 years, Pakistan-China relations have evolved into an exemplary partnership rooted in mutual respect and collective growth. Highlighting China’s development model, discipline, and national commitment as an inspiration for Pakistan’s future progress, she urged students to promote education, research, discipline, and national harmony.ÚÚThe ceremony featured special documentaries on the Pakistan-China friendship, CPEC, Gwadar Port, and ongoing development projects, along with cultural performances and a poster exhibition to celebrate the longstanding ties between the two countries. The event was jointly organized by the Directorate of Student Affairs, the Departments of Political Science and Islamic Studies, and the Confucius Center GCWUF Chapter. A large number of faculty members and students attended the event, which concluded with a cake-cutting ceremony to commemorate the deep diplomatic bond.
